    /**!
     * Draws the text to the image buffer.
     *
     * The given point represents the baseline of the left edge of the font,
     * regardless of whether it is left-to-right or right-to-left (in the case of
     *      RTL text, this will actually represent the logical end of the text).
     *
     * The clip is optional and may be NULL. In this case, the text will be
     * clipped to the image.
     *
     * The image_data_is_opaque flag indicates whether subpixel antialiasing can
     * be performed, if it is supported. When the image below the text is
     * opaque, subpixel antialiasing is supported and you should set this to
     * PP_TRUE to pick up the user's default preferences. If your plugin is
     * partially transparent, then subpixel antialiasing is not possible and
     * grayscale antialiasing will be used instead (assuming the user has
     *      antialiasing enabled at all).
     */
    pub fn draw_text<TStr: super::ToStringVar +
        super::ToVar>(&self,
                      image: &imagedata::ImageData,
                      text: &TStr,
                      rtl: bool,
                      override_direction: bool,
                      pos: super::Point,
                      color: u32,
                      clip: Option<super::Rect>,
                      image_data_is_opaque: bool) -> super::Code {
            let font_res = self.unwrap();
            let image_res = image.unwrap();
            let text_run = Struct_PP_TextRun_Dev {
                text: text.to_var(),
                rtl: rtl as u32,
                override_direction: override_direction as u32,
            };
            let pos_ptr = &pos as *const super::Point;
            let clip_ptr = if clip.is_some() { clip.as_ref().unwrap() as *const super::Rect}
                           else              { ptr::null() };
            if (ppb::get_font().DrawTextAt.unwrap())
                (font_res,
                 image_res,
                 &text_run as *const Struct_PP_TextRun_Dev,
                 pos_ptr,
                 color,
                 clip_ptr,
                 image_data_is_opaque as ffi::PP_Bool) as i32 != -1 {
                super::Code::Ok
            } else { super::Code::Failed }
        }
